Output 106b757915d2cf0b8ea8f360942b1dc23b6e50ecc3ad997ca00e220d80983367:4

value
66480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2755f9f55fa98b23df52940430d4dd62f0d60e6c OP_EQUAL
address
35H1Gmd5psQgXNpZZWwqWVBmSPkcTcbu48
transaction
106b757915d2cf0b8ea8f360942b1dc23b6e50ecc3ad997ca00e220d80983367
spent
true